CCC Community Christmas Events

The Centennial Cultural Center had a busy week as they held two big Christmas events at their facility in Olla.

On the night of December 9, the annual Community Christmas Singing event was held with many special guest singers participating.

A great crowd was on hand to enjoy the music as the community came together with the Christmas season in full swing.

On Saturday, December 14, the CCC’s annual Cookies with Santa event was held with many children attending. At the event, the children visited with Santa Claus, sang Christmas songs, created ornament crafts and decorated Christmas sugar cookies.

Deborah Hailey of Tales on the Trails was also on hand where she signed the children up for the Dolly Parton’s Imagination Library.
